What does a contract packaging engineer do?

A Contract Packaging Engineer specializes in designing, developing, and managing packaging solutions for products, often working for third-party companies that handle packaging for clients. They ensure that packaging meets safety, regulatory, and branding requirements while optimizing for cost and efficiency. Their role may involve selecting appropriate materials, testing package durability, and coordinating with manufacturers and logistics teams. These engineers also help streamline the packing process to improve productivity and reduce waste, making them essential for companies looking to outsource their packaging needs.

What is the difference between Contract Packaging Engineer vs Packaging Technician?

AspectContract Packaging EngineerPackaging Technician
CredentialsBachelor's degree in engineering, packaging, or related field; certifications like PMP or Six Sigma beneficialHigh school diploma or equivalent; technical training or certifications preferred
Work EnvironmentDesign, plan, and oversee packaging projects; collaborate with manufacturing and quality teamsOperate packaging machinery; perform packaging tasks on production lines
Industry UsageUsed across manufacturing, consumer goods, and pharmaceutical industries for project managementCommonly found in production facilities handling daily packaging operations

The Contract Packaging Engineer focuses on designing and managing packaging projects, requiring engineering knowledge and project management skills. In contrast, the Packaging Technician handles the hands-on operation of packaging equipment, ensuring daily production runs smoothly. Both roles are essential in the packaging process but differ in scope, responsibilities, and required qualifications.

Junior Packaging Engineer

Job Description:

RFIC package development, supporting NPI from concept through production release.  This individual will work with product and design engineers to deliver optimum, cost effective packaging solutions as well as providing thermal design and analysis for IC package and system level physical designs.  Package types include plastic molded leadframe packages, ceramic packages and metal packages for RF and Microwave IC's.  This individual may be required to work on multiple product development programs in parallel to deliver packaging solutions on schedule for high volume manufacturing.

Responsibilities:

  • Provide technical support for RF/microwave plastic, ceramic and metal packages
  • Work with internal product design, QA, Reliability, Failure Analysis, supply chain, and the external suppliers to develop and apply and qualify the appropriate packaging technologies and assembly processes, with focus on cost, high volume manufacturability, yield and quality
  • Provide thermal and mechanical modeling for new packages and for improving existing package designs
  • Update design rules for packaging as required
  • Participate in and contribute to assembly process development internally and at our contract manufacturers
  • Participate in troubleshooting IC packaging defects, then define and implement solutions
